Who Originally Wrote The Lirik Autumn Leaves Song?

2 Jawaban2025-09-19 23:38:12
The song 'Autumn Leaves' has a fascinating history that captures the essence of artistic collaboration. Originally, the music was composed in 1945 by the brilliant Joseph Kosma, who was a Hungarian-French composer. But it was the poignant lyrics that truly brought the song to life, and they were penned by poet and songwriter Jacques Prévert. His words evoke such beautiful imagery of nostalgia and melancholy, perfectly capturing the changing seasons. The song’s magic doesn’t end there. It’s interesting to note that the English lyrics were added later by Johnny Mercer in 1947, opening up a whole new realm of interpretation and appreciation for audiences beyond French speakers. Each version conveys a unique emotional depth, whether it be in the original French or the English rendition. It’s amazing to see how 'Autumn Leaves' has been embraced by multiple artists across genres, from jazz legends like Nat King Cole, whose sultry vocal delivery brought a new flavor to the song, to the heartfelt interpretations by contemporary singers. What Is The History Behind The Lirik Autumn Leaves Melody?

3 Jawaban2025-09-19 09:19:02
The melody 'Autumn Leaves' has such a rich and profound history, and I just love exploring its journey through music! Originally composed by Joseph Kosma in 1945, the piece was based on a French poem titled 'Les Feuilles mortes' (The Dead Leaves) written by Jacques Prevert. The lyrics evoke the beauty of autumn and the bittersweet feelings that come with memories of love lost, setting such a lovely melancholic tone that it's hard not to get swept away in the emotions it conjures. Fast forward to the mid-20th century, and 'Autumn Leaves' became popular in jazz, gaining iconic status with many legendary artists covering it. You’ve got figures like Nat King Cole and Frank Sinatra, whose renditions brought the song to new audiences, blending pop and jazz while retaining that poignant touch. What’s fascinating is how it morphed through the years; different musicians have added their own flair, from slow ballads to fast-paced jazz interpretations. Each artist seems to grasp different aspects of the melody, striking different emotional chords.
